Definitions:

Statute of Frauds

A legal principle requiring certain types of contracts to be in writing and duly signed by all parties involved, to be enforceable.

Promissory Estoppel

A legal principle that prevents a party from going back on a promise, even if it was not formally agreed to in a contract, if someone else has relied on that promise to their detriment.

Tort of Deceit

A legal cause of action that arises when one party intentionally lies or misrepresents a material fact with the intent to deceive another, causing harm.

Guarantor

An individual or entity that agrees to be responsible for another's debt or performance under a contract, should the primary party fail to meet its obligations.
